About Igor Askeyev

Igor Askeyev is a scholar working on Ecology, Nature and Landscape Conservation, Ecological Modeling, Aquatic Science and Genetics, having authored 41 papers that have together received 279 indexed citations. Recurring topics across this work include Fish Ecology and Management Studies (11 papers), Species Distribution and Climate Change (10 papers), Fish Biology and Ecology Studies (9 papers), Archaeology and ancient environmental studies (7 papers), Avian ecology and behavior (6 papers), Aquatic Invertebrate Ecology and Behavior (6 papers), Genetic diversity and population structure (5 papers) and Climate variability and models (4 papers). The work is most often cited by research in Ecological Modeling (72 citations), Nature and Landscape Conservation (127 citations), Aquatic Science (51 citations), Ecology (149 citations) and Archeology (4 citations). Igor Askeyev has collaborated with scholars based in Russia, Poland and United Kingdom. Frequent co-authors include Oleg Askeyev, Tim H. Sparks, Piotr Tryjanowski, Saša Marić, Aleš Snoj, Kees Hulsman, Jeremy B. Searle, M. Heikkinen, Laura Kvist and Jouni Aspi. Their work appears in journals such as Povolzhskaya Arkheologiya (The Volga River Region Archaeology), International Journal of Biometeorology, International Journal of Osteoarchaeology, Global Ecology and Biogeography and Royal Society Open Science.
